*****Tiling Safety and Best Practices: Avoiding Common PitfallsCourse Syllabus*****
Lecture 1: Introduction to Tiling Safety
- Lesson-1 Understanding the Importance of Tiling Safety
- Lesson-2 Legal Framework and Regulations in the UK
- Lesson-3 Personal Protective Equipment (PPE)
Lecture 2: Preparing for a Tiling Project
- Lesson-1 Site Assessment and Hazard Identification
- Lesson-2 Preparing the Work Area
- Lesson-3 Tools and Equipment Inspection and Maintenance
Lecture 3: Proper Tile Selection and Material Handling
- Lesson-1 Choosing the Right Tiles for the Job
- Lesson-2 Handling and Transporting Tiles Safely
- Lesson-3 Adhesives, Grouts, and Sealants
Lecture 4: Surface Preparation and Substrate Considerations
- Lesson-1 Surface Assessment and Preparation
- Lesson-2 Dealing with Substrate Issues
- Lesson-3 Waterproofing and Moisture Management
Lecture 5: Tiling Installation Best Practices
- Lesson-1 Setting Out and Planning the Tile Layout
- Lesson-2 Cutting and Shaping Tiles Safely
- Lesson-3 Adhesive Application and Tile Installation
- Lesson-4 Grouting and Finishing
Lecture 6: Common Mistakes and Pitfalls
- Lesson-1 Identifying and Avoiding Common Tiling Mistakes
- Lesson-2 Quality Control and Inspection
- Lesson-3 Troubleshooting and Corrections
Lecture 7: Health and Safety on the Job
- Lesson-1 Preventing Slips, Trips, and Falls
- Lesson-2 Dust and Respiratory Protection
- Lesson-3 Electrical Safety and Tool Usage
Lecture 8: Cleaning, Maintenance, and Post-Installation Care
- Lesson-1 Cleaning Grout Haze and Tile Surfaces
- Lesson-2 Maintenance and Repair of Tiled Areas
- Lesson-3 Customer Handover and Documentation
Lecture 9: Review and Assessment
- Lesson-1 Course Recap and Key Takeaways
- Lesson-2 Assessment and Knowledge Check
